CSS 固定元素是指在 HTML 文檔中使用 CSS 樣式來定位和固定某個元素的位置,從而避免元素在頁面中移動或重疊。
使用 CSS 固定元素可以有效地避免元素的移動和重疊,使頁面布局更加美觀和易于維護。固定元素通常用于布局中的層疊樣式和嵌套樣式,以及頁面中的網(wǎng)格布局。
下面是一些使用 CSS 固定元素的技巧:
1. 使用絕對定位:將元素設置為 `position: absolute`,并使用距離和角度屬性來固定其位置。例如,`position: absolute; top: 50%; left: 50%; transform: translateX(-50%);`可以將元素固定在頁面中心的 50% 位置,并使用 translateX 屬性將元素向左移動 50%。
2. 使用相對定位:將元素設置為 `position: relative`,并使用距離和角度屬性來調整其位置。例如,`position: relative; top: 50%; left: 50%; transform: translateX(-50%);`可以將元素固定在頁面中心的 50% 位置,并使用 translateX 屬性將元素向右移動 50%。
3. 使用包圍盒:將元素設置為 `position:包圍盒`,并通過 CSS 的 `top`、`left`、`right` 和 `bottom` 屬性來包圍元素。例如,`position:包圍盒; top: 50%; left: 50%; transform: translateX(-50%);`可以將元素固定在頁面中心的 50% 位置,并使用 translateX 屬性將元素向右移動 50%。
4. 使用Flexbox布局:使用 Flexbox 布局可以將元素設置為 `display: flex;`,并通過 CSS 的 `justify-content`、`align-items` 和 `flex-direction` 屬性來固定元素的位置。例如,`display: flex; justify-content: space-between; align-items: center; flex-direction: column;`可以將元素放置在頁面的兩側,并通過 space-between 屬性將元素之間的距離保持在 1 像素。
CSS 固定元素是網(wǎng)頁布局中非常重要的一部分,可以幫助我們更好地控制元素的位置和大小,提高頁面的可讀性和美觀度。